Hello Freesurfer's
I am trying to look at the cortical thickness for a specific ROI on the cortical surface (Primary Auditory Cortex: transverse temporal gyri). I found a specific tutorial (https://surfer.nmr.mgh.harvard.edu/fswiki/VolumeRoiCorticalThickness) however the tutorial assumes I already have an ROI mask created. I was wondering if anyone had any tips on creating an ROI for the cortical surface from the parcellation/annotation files. I know you can "hand-draw" ROI's in tkmedit or freeview but I would prefer something less subjective that doesn't rely on my untrained eye and unsteady hand! Thanks in advance.

Hi Michael
you can use mri_annotation2label to extract a specific label from the aparc file and go from there.

It is just a text file, so you can just look in it. You can also run aparcstats2table to extract all ROIs or a particular ROI for a group of subjects. doug
